CLOTHES SIZES

measure over the type of undergarments you'd normally wear with your new outfit...

inches or centimetres - either is OK, hold tape comfortably snug, but not too tight...

measuring the gals...
figure
ref
details
f-a
1
high bust:   measure directly under your arms, straight across your back and above your bust.
f-a
2
bust:   measure around the fullest part of your bust and straight across your back.
f-a
3
waist:   measure around your body at your natural waistline, don't hold the tape too tight.
f-a
4
hip:   measure around your body at the fullest part - usually about 7" - 10" (18 - 25cm) below your waist.
f-a
5
back to waist:   measure from the most prominent bone at the base of your neck to your natural waistline.
f-a
6
waist to hip:   measure vertically from your natural waistline to your hip.
f-b
7
shoulder + arm:   determine your neckline...   bend your arm slightly...   measure the shoulder from your neckline to the tip of your shoulder bone...   write down this measurement  -  then without moving the tape, and with your arm slightly bent, measure down over elbow to your wrist...   deduct shoulder width to determine your arm length...   we'll need both measurements.
f-c
8
outside leg:   measure at your side from your natural waistline over your hip bone to the length you wish your pants to be...   this is the length of the outside leg seam.
f-c
9
inside leg:   measure from your crotch to the length you wish the pants to be...   this is the length of the inside leg seam.
f-c
10
skirt length:   measure from your natural waistline to the length you wish your skirt to be.
f-d
11
dress length:   measure from the most prominent bone at the base of your neck to the length you wish your dress to be...   be sure to consider if your dress will be worn with a belt.

measuring the guys...
figure
ref
details
m-a
1
neck:   measure around the base of your neck...   ensure you allow sufficient neck clearance if you want a button-up collar.
m-a
2
chest:   measure around the widest part of your chest and straight across your back under your arms.
m-a
3
waist:   measure around your body at your natural waistline, don't hold the tape too tight.
m-a
4
hip:   measure around your body at the fullest part - this is usually about 8" - 12" (20 - 30cm) below your waist.
m-b
5
shoulder + arm:   determine your neckline...   bend your arm slightly...   measure the shoulder from your neckline to the tip of your shoulder bone...   write down this measurement  -  then without moving the tape, and with your arm slightly bent, measure down over elbow to your wrist...   deduct shoulder width to determine your arm length...   we'll need both measurements.
m-c
6
outside leg:   measure at your side from your natural waistline over your hip bone to the length you wish your pants to be...   this is the length of the outside leg seam.
m-c
7
inside leg:   measure from your crotch to the length you wish the pants to be...   this is the length of the inside leg seam.
m-d
8
shirt length:   measure from the most prominent bone at the base of your neck to the length you want your garment to be.

Bowling Shirt Measuring
(for guys 'n' gals)
Bowling Shirts were obviously first designed for 10 pin bowling, so that
the bowlers could “s-t-r-e-t-c-h”  -  hence the rear gussets (pleats),
& by their "very nature", bowling shirts are “loose fitting”
Bowling shirts were then “adopted” by swing dancers and later
on by rock `n' roll & rockabilly dancers, because they also
wanted the “s-t-r-e-t-c-h” for when they were dancing
Please provide your actual body measurements and we will make the
appropriate adjustments to ensure a correct "bowling shirt fit"
A:      Around Chest - inches or centimetres
B:      Around Waist - inches or centimetres
C:      Around Hips - inches or centimetres
D:      From rear collar base to finished shirt length
E:      From collar base to finished sleeve end
F:      Around Arm - inches or centimetres - short sleeve
F:      Around Arm - inches or centimetres - long sleeve
